The junior didn\u2019t finish two of the games \u2014 including the LA Bowl \u2014 due to injury.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-3\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"64\">Backup Max Cutforth performed a bit better in Boise State\u2019s losses, completing 43 of 67 (64 percent) passes for 443 yards with two touchdowns and five picks.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-4\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"67\">Madsen tossed two ghastly interceptions in the first half of the LA Bowl and had a career-worst four picks at Notre Dame. In his five career appearances against Power Four teams, Madsen has two passing touchdowns and nine interceptions.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-5\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6a\">After the Notre Dame game, Boise State head coach Spencer Danielson launched a vigorous defense of his embattled quarterback.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-6\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6d\">\u201cHowever a game goes, the first finger gets pointed at the head coach \u2014 as it should \u2014 and then usually people try to nitpick the starting quarterback,\u201d Danielson said back in October. \u201cI don\u2019t care where you\u2019re at, who you are, that\u2019s football in general.<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-7\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6g\">\u201cMaddux Madsen is a warrior. I will go to war with Maddux Madsen any day of the week. There\u2019s not a quarterback in the country that I would like to be the quarterback of our team (more) than Maddux Madsen. Period, end of story.\u201d<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-8\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6j\">The ultimate underdog, Madsen was rated the No. 31 overall prospect in Utah and the No. 106 quarterback prospect nationally in the 247Sports class of 2022 composite rankings. His only other scholarship offer coming out of American Fork High School was from New Mexico.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-9\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6m\">Madsen made one start as a redshirt freshman in 2023 and beat out highly-touted transfer Malachi Nelson for the starting job last season. The Broncos went on to finish 12-2 overall and reach the College Football Playoff for the first time in program history.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-10\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6p\">After missing the final three games of the 2025 regular season with an unspecified lower leg injury, Madsen returned for the Mountain West championship game and torched UNLV for four total touchdowns. The Broncos cruised to a 38-21 victory, claiming their third straight MWC title.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-11\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6s\">The good vibes faded quickly as Madsen finished the LA Bowl 7 of 16 passing for 51 yards with two picks. He watched the second half from the sideline with a boot on his right foot.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-12\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6v\">As the Broncos prepare to join the Pac-12 next summer, Danielson said he is content with a quarterback room featuring Madsen, Cutforth, walk-on Zeke Martinez and incoming freshmen Cash Herrera and Jackson Taylor.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p id=\"inline-text-13\" class=\"my-[18px] [&amp;_a]:text-primary my-f-1.5\" q:key=\"0\" q:id=\"6y\">\u201c(Madsen) is our quarterback,\u201d Danielson said after the LA Bowl.
